A WOMAN who had her teeth fixed in Turkey has shared a video warning others not to make the same mistake.

Keisha-Louise explained that the company assured her they could straighten her “crooked” teeth “a trillion percent.”

They then said they could schedule her right away, meaning she had no ‘down time’ before having to make the booking.

“I was originally going to go there for veneers, but someone said I shouldn’t get them because they bleed,” she said in the TikTok video.

“So I went for crowns.”

When she got there, they “went straight to work” and fixed her teeth, but they “weren’t straight.”

“I was furious,” she admitted.

“I said, ‘You told me they were going to be straight,’ and then they denied it and said, ‘No, we’re not, no, we’re not!’

“There’s one reason not to do it: they’re just lying!”

Keisha-Louise added that even after paying “all the money” for the teeth, they were still broken and crooked, so she plans to go back to have them fixed.

But she said the company kept “changing the dates” before sending her an email with an offer for laminate veneers, adding salt to the wound.

“Honey, I ground my teeth down to the ground,” she raged.

Dentist-Approved Teeth Whitening Tips

ERIN Fraundorf, DMD, MSD, owner of BOCA Orthodontic + Whitening Studio in Missouri, shared her top tips for whiter teeth.

Seek professional bleaching treatment. It is often stronger and will be the most effective so you don’t waste your money on a product that won’t work or could cause you harm. You also only get one set of teeth so it’s best not to experiment with it.

Think about the cause of the stains. There are numerous causes of teeth turning yellow or brown. Make sure you are evaluated and diagnosed by a professional to ensure you get the best treatment for your stains. Not all stains are the same, so they may require different treatments.

Consider your lifestyle, your smile goals, and your budget. When choosing a whitening treatment that’s right for you, there are several factors to consider when designing a customized plan. Some people want to whiten at home, others prefer in-office treatments, some need to get really light really quickly — for a wedding, for example — while others want a gentler, gradual, consistent approach to whitening.

Take it easy. Start whitening your teeth gradually so that your teeth can get used to it. You can monitor the sensitivity of your teeth closely and determine how often you want to whiten your teeth.

Try to avoid. Make small lifestyle changes to help prevent stains from penetrating your teeth. For example, drink staining beverages through a straw, rinse with plain water after drinking something that stains, and choose still water instead of sparkling water whenever possible.

Water flosser to remove stains between teeth. Remove stubborn stains between your teeth with a water flosser, as the bristles of a toothbrush can only reach a limited part of the tooth surface.
